What Is Alcoholism. Alcoholism has been known by a variety of terms, including alcohol abuse and alcohol dependence. Alcoholism most often refers to alcohol use disorder—a problematic pattern of drinking that leads to impairment or distress—which can be characterized as. An alcoholic is an individual who has a mental and physical dependence on alcohol. Continued excessive or compulsive use of alcoholic drinks.

The national institute on alcohol abuse and alcoholism says that about 18 million people in the united states. The definition of alcoholism is chronic alcohol use to the degree that it interferes with physical or mental health, or with normal social or work behavior. Alcoholism refers to use of alcohol that results in an individual experiencing significant distress and or dysfunction in daily life. Alcoholism, or alcohol dependence, is now recognized as part of alcohol use disorder — which also includes classic symptoms of alcohol abuse. Alcoholism, now known as alcohol use disorder, is a condition in which a person has a desire or physical need to consume alcohol, even though it has a negative impact on their life. Alcoholism is a disease characterized by the habitual intake of alcohol.

Alcoholism, on the other hand, means a person needs alcohol to get through their day.

For example, wine is made from the sugar in grapes, beer from the sugar in malted barley (a type of grain), cider from the sugar in apples. It is a destructive pattern of alcohol use that includes tolerance to or withdrawal from the substance, using more alcohol or using it for longer than planned, and trouble reducing its use or inability to use it in moderation. Alcoholism formerly called alcohol dependence or alcohol addiction, is the more severe end of the alcohol use disorder spectrum.
